We prove the following three closely related results. The first is that every finite simple group has a profinite presentation with 2 generators and at most 18 relations. The second is that if G is a finite simple group, F a field and M an FG-module, then the dimension of the second cohomology group of G with coefficients in M is at most 17.5 times the dimension of M. The third result is that we may replace 17.5 by 18.5 as long as M is faithful irreducible G-module. These last two results answer conjectures of Holt.
